Going Global

Web Localization: Applying International SEO to Achieve a Bigger Global Reach.

Web localization is a powerful tool and when used right can create a strong presence in countries both near and far. That’s why creating the best online experience lies at the heart of many global marketing strategies. There’s so much more to web localization than what was mentioned before; this includes the use of techniques […]